What is an Umbrella Company?

An Umbrella Company is an employer; one that employs people who work on temporary assignments.

The working life of a contractor can be extremely varied. Different jobs, different workplaces, different recruitment agencies. Key Portfolio is your constant companion through it all.

We pay you for the assignments that your agencies find for you and give you a range of employment-related benefits that you wouldn’t ordinarily have access to.

So while you’re enjoying the freedom and flexibility of contracting, you can also enjoy the stability and safety net that comes from employment.